Canyon Football Team Forfeits Game Against Golden Valley

khts_sportsThe Canyon football team will have to give back its share of the Foothill League championship after using an ineligible player against Golden Valley on Thursday night.

Canyon forfeits the game and leaves Valencia as the lone winner of the Foothill League title. Canyon and Valencia finished in a tie for first place in league with 4-1 records.

Canyon coach Rich Gutierrez said the ineligible player was in the game for two plays when he emptied his bench in the fourth quarter of a 48-21 blowout against Golden Valley.

Canyon’s spot in the CIF Southern Section Northern Division playoffs will not be affected. The Cowboys play Palmdale in the first round on Friday night.

Golden Valley is credited with its first Foothill League win in school history.
